In commemoration of International Missing Children’s Day on May 25, Huiyuan Juice Group joined hands with Baobei Huijia (literally translated as “babies come home”), a volunteer group dedicated to finding lost children, launched a series of packing boxes with missing children’s posters. JD Logistics will carry out the delivery of these boxes, spreading the information and raising public awareness while fulfilling the express service through its nationwide network.
Photos and detailed descriptions are printed on the boxes, and people can directly contact the volunteer group to provide helpful information. Many customers who order juice products on Huiyuan’s official stores on JD.com and Douyin will receive their purchases in these boxes featuring the missing children’s information. A Huiyuan spokesperson estimated that in the lead up to the 618 Grand Promotion, these boxes could reach hundreds of thousands of users in a month.
JD.com and Huiyuan started logistics cooperation in March of this year. At present, JD Logistics is fully responsible for the express delivery operation in 10 of Huiyuan’s core factories in China, ensuring that over 80 percent of its orders are delivered to consumers’ doorsteps the same or next day.
The two companies are also eyeing all-round cooperation in the field of digital agriculture in the near future to enhance user experience and contribute their strength to the undertakings of social welfare and sustainable growth.
JD.com released its 2021 ESG Report on May 24th in which the company specified its compliance management mechanism guided by the concept of “achieving success the right way,” and the principle of “compliance represents development”.
JD.com “complies with laws and regulations, builds a culture of integrity and anti-corruption, enables effective compliance management driven by technology and data, and establishes a forward-looking, flexible, and efficient compliance system,” said the report.
Five key actions are outlined to ensure the company’s all-around compliance management, they are 1) laws and regulations compliance, 2) anti-corruption and integrity compliance, 3) information security compliance, 4) auditing compliance and 5) transaction risk control.
The management of these areas is effectively protected through three “defensive lines”, which are composed of 1) every employee of the company; 2) risk management teams including legal, finance, information, security and risk control; and 3) independent supervisory and audit teams.
Multiple enforcement mechanisms are in place including continuous public promotion and education, a joint accountability principle with collateral penalties in major compliance issues, rewards for employees who contribute to the compliance work and more.
JD.com adopts a “zero tolerance” attitude towards corruption. It has established sound anti-corruption management regulations and systems, including the JD.com Business Conduct and Ethics Code, JD.com Anti-Corruption Regulations, JD.com Whistleblower Protection and Reward System, etc. Additionally, all JD employees receive anti-corruption training and assessment every year. All new hires must take the courses and pass the examination before their probation period has been completed.
JD.com also attaches great importance to its supplier management and promotes measures for greater social and environmental good through business cooperation. JD formulated its regulations on green procurement management in 2020, integrating environmental protection requirements and also formulating a negative list to guide its suppliers’ practice. Meanwhile, JD strictly forbids its suppliers to engage in behaviors including illegal employment, breaching of labor laws and other violations.

In JD.com’s 2022 ESG report released on May 24, JD.com continues to deepen its environmental protection strategy and promote green development through corporate operations, supply chain management, and driving consumers’ green life.
JD.com continues to accelerate the strategy of its low-carbon operation. In 2021, all office buildings built by JD.com acquired three-star design mark certification for green buildings, and the new green data center operated by JD Cloud achieved annual operation with a Power Usage Effectiveness (PUE) lower than 1.1 (the closer the PUE ratio is to 1.0 the better energy effective it is).
JD.com continues to deploy new energy vehicles on the road, promote circular packaging, and build “zero-carbon” logistics parks to lead the entire supply chain to achieve low-carbon efficiency. In addition, JD.com announced the new five-year “Green Stream Initiative”, and promised to continue to invest RMB 1 billion yuan in constructing a low-carbon integrated supply chain.
JD.com promotes green consumption by expanding the categories of low-carbon commodities, and it drives more businesses and consumers to join the low-carbon consumption actions.
JD.com has carried out a series of renovations to promote energy conservation and resource recycling through office practices and green data centers.
JD.com’s own office buildings are equipped with an intelligent operation and maintenance system, which can monitor the energy required for office work and propose energy-saving solutions for specific areas in real-time. In 2021, all the traditional lighting lamps in public areas of JD’s Building No.1 in Beijing have been transformed into LED lamps, with a total of more than 14,000 LED downlights replaced. After the replacement, the lighting power consumption in the office area of Building No.1 was reduced by 5000-9000kWh per day on average.
At the same time, JD.com has also created a wireless and paperless office environment. In JD.com’s office space, 5,520 wireless routers have been connected, and a total of 179 servers have been optimized, saving about 470,000 kWh of electricity per year and consequently reducing carbon emissions by about 286.7 tons. In 2021, JD.com has issued more than 2.8 billion electronic invoices, saving about 16,000 tons of paper, equivalent to saving more than 310,000 trees and reducing carbon emissions by 15,000 tons.
In addition to the green renovation of the office space, JD.com provides commuter shuttle services for employees. There are a total of 200 shuttle buses traveling to and from JD headquarters, including 80 new energy buses with an annual traveled mileage of 1.273 million kilometers, which reduces carbon emissions by about 742.2 tons.
Through green operations, JD has achieved green data center practices with a lower carbon footprint. Taking the East China Suqian data center in Jiangsu province as an example, its footprint has been reduced by 45%, while its power supply efficiency now reaches as high as 95.3%, and the direct-current (DC) efficiency is as high as 97%.
In addition, JD Cloud has established cooperation with Huawei co-launching innovative solutions for energy saving and emission reduction, including an intelligent indirect evaporative cooling system EHU (Environment Handling Unit), which can automatically switch the cooling mode according to the climate, and directly use the natural cold air of the data center to cool the computer room with AI comprehensive energy efficiency optimization technology, and medium voltage direct supply integrated power supply system SST, which strengthens the recycling of cooling energy resources.
JD contributes to China’s carbon neutrality goal and global climate action by building a cleaner supply chain system with a lower carbon footprint. Last year, JD.com was officially selected as one of the “Best Practices for Enterprises to Achieve Sustainable Development Goals 2021 (carbon peak and carbon neutrality goals)” awarded by Global Compact China Network. Nowadays, JD’s green supply chain efforts span packaging, warehousing, and transportation.
In terms of packaging materials, JD.com advocates the use of green degradable materials to replace petroleum-based plastic bags. Meanwhile, JD Logistics uses reusable circular delivery boxes, foldable thermal insulation boxes, and circular packaging bags instead of disposable plastic packaging. By the end of 2021, circular packaging such as “Green Stream Boxes” have been used 200 million times. During the Singles Day Grand Promotion in 2021, each parcel delivered to consumers reduced paper packaging materials by 210 grams. Each parcel reduced disposable plastics by 11 grams and 25 centimeters of adhesive tape on average.
In addition to packaging, JD.com is also actively promoting green warehousing. At present, JD.com is promoting more intelligent industrial parks to achieve zero carbon emissions. Take JD.com’s Xi’an Asia No. 1 Logistics Industrial Park as an example, which has become the first “zero-carbon” logistics park in China. In addition, JD’s Logistics Industrial Parks were equipped with a rainwater collection system and photovoltaic power generation systems. The rainwater collection system can use all the collected rainwater for irrigation and road cleaning in the park. The photovoltaic power generation system can help parks reduce carbon dioxide emissions which have been installed in 12 smart industrial parks. Through low-carbon design, JD.com has helped partners achieve greener and pioneering brands. JD.com provided BMW Hefei with customized services for constructing the regional aftermarket parts center, which has obtained L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design) certification. BMW Hefei Aftermarket Parts Distribution Center has become BMW’s first “green warehouse” of aftermarket parts in China that meets LEED certification standards, providing an excellent model for green warehousing development.
Green transportation is also an important part of JD’s supply chain management. JD Logistics has deployed new energy vehicles in more than 50 cities across the country to replace traditional fuel cargo vans. By the end of 2021, the number of new energy logistics vehicles has reached 20,000 distributed in over 25 cities across the country, which can reduce carbon dioxide emissions by about 400,000 tons per year, equivalent to the annual carbon dioxide absorption by 20 million trees.
JD.com advocates sustainable consumption concepts and green lifestyles through JD’s Singles Day Grand Promotion. In 2021, JD.com offered more than 150 million types of products that meet the “green consumption” standards during the Singles Day Grand Promotion. As of November 7, 2021, consumers had purchased more than 3.5 million energy-saving products and more than 400,000 water-saving products from JD.com. On the aspect of logistics services, recycled packages were used 11.35 million times accumulatively during the festival, which is equivalent to reducing the disposable garbage by 3,400 tons. At the same time, JD Logistics’ all-chain carbon reduction measures throughout the logistics processes reduced carbon emissions by 26,000 tons during the event.
